Step 1: Emergency Response and Assessment
We’ll respond to your call and assess the situation to find out the extent of the damage. Our team will use thermal imaging cameras to identify hidden moisture and assess the structural integrity of your walls. We’ll identify the source of the water and create a plan to extract the water and dry the area. This step typically takes about 30 minutes to an hour.
Step 2: Equipment Setup and Extraction
Next, our technicians will set up our specialized equipment, including our truck-mounted water extraction system, to start removing the water from your wall cavities. We use a combination of pumps and extraction equipment to safely and efficiently remove the water. This step can take anywhere from 2 to 4 hours,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, our team will use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ry the area and remove any remaining moisture. We monitor the drying process to ensure that your walls and surrounding areas are completely dry and free from moisture. This step can take anywhere from 2 to 5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.

Common Questions About Wall Cavity Water Extraction
What is Wall Cavity Water Extraction?
Wall cavity water extraction is the process of removing water from the wall cavities of your home to prevent further damage and secondary issues.
How Do I Know If I Have Wall Cavity Water Damage?
Look for visible water damage, warping or buckling drywall, discoloration or staining on walls or ceilings, and musty odors.
How Long Does Wall Cavity Water Extraction Take?
The length of time required for wall cavity water extraction dep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Typically, it takes 2 to 4 hours to extract the water, and 2 to 5 days to dry the area.
Is Wall Cavity Water Extraction Covered by Insurance?
Yes, wall cavity water extraction may be covered by your insurance policy. Check with your insurance provider to find out the extent of coverage.
